DIGITAL DENTURES
Here’s how we do it:
Digital dentures are modern, computer-designed dental prosthetics created using advanced CAD/CAM (Computer-Aided Design / Computer-Aided Manufacturing) technology. Unlike traditional dentures, which are made by hand through multiple physical impressions and adjustments, digital dentures are crafted using digital scans, 3D design software, and precision milling or 3D printing.
